Address

bc1phvxpht3g7mpzrve5htakuf4qstde0e5njz5zudsj56wh0gyh9yds980dytCopy

Total Received

2.15037849 BTC

Total Sent

2.10571203 BTC

№ Transactions

144

Final Balance

0.04466646 BTC

Transactions
Filter